Ottocento Antico Velluto is a decorative coating for interiors that adapts perfectly to both classical as well as contemporary interiors. The products finish captures light and subtly reflects it as if it were a precious fabric on the surface enveloping the interior and creating a notable decorative effect with an assured, classy feel.

The material is characterised by the special pigments within its composition that create the effect and render it also a perfect alternative to fabric wall coatings, wall papers or drapes. Ottocento is a highly innovative product with a Low Environmental Impact, ecological and friendly to both humans and the environment, its decorative potential is further enhanced by its technical characteristics including a higher level of permeability to water vapour enabling the natural evaporation of humidity from in the surface rendering living spaces more hygienic and creating a general improvement in the air quality in interior spaces.

The application of this material is straight forward and consists of the application by roller, of a base coat called Supercolor in the indicated colour to match the finish and a single coat applied by trowel of Ottocento. The products creamy consistency makes it very simple to spread and on top of the effect itself, the long open time eliminates any possibility of joins in the application. The effect is created , once the product has been generally spread on the surface in a fine layer, by moving over the surface with a clean trowel just as it starts to set off, allowing the still moist areas to smear out over the surface and blend with those areas that have already started to dry. The effect that is generated is not only a visual effect that is pleasing on the eye, it also creates a soft velvety feel over the surface that is extremely pleasant to the touch.

The product is available in a an extensive range of 160 colours, that includes both the latest colours from the world of interior design as well as those shades that fit perfectly into all everyday Interior spaces and settings. Combining different colours of the base coat with a different colour of Ottocento or even applying several colours of Ottocento at the same time, increase yet further the creative possibilities that Ottocento offers and further demonstrates the materials versatility and ease of use. The finish is capable of generating a stunning atmosphere that enriching interiors in both the residential and commercial sectors.

Ottocento Antico Velluto, as with all the products in the Oikos ranges are water based and environmentally friendly with all VOC levels well below the latest stringent levels set by the European community.
